To compete successfully, a producer should ensure that they must produce goods that are of a higher quality than those of their competitors.
The quality of a product is usually a deterministic characteristic of how the public will receive such material.
- A quality good produced gives consumers better value for money spent in procuring them.
- This will ensure a high reliability on the part of the consumers towards the producers.
- Even at higher prices, most consumers will crave for a good and quality product since they are rest assured of getting maximum value from it.
Therefore, a higher quality of goods produced will make a producer compete more successfully.
